Section 1 โ Manual VPN setup in Windows (step-by-step) These steps match current Windows 10/11 flows; labels may differ slightly by build.
- Gather credentials
- Provider name, server address or hostname, VPN type (OpenVPN, L2TP/IPsec, IKEv2, WireGuard), username and password, any pre-shared key or certificate files.
- Open the Settings app
- Start > Settings > Network & Internet.
- Add a VPN profile
- Choose VPN > Add a VPN connection.
- VPN provider: “Windows (built-in)”.
- Connection name: a friendly label (e.g., “MyVPN โ ProviderName US”).
- Server name or address: paste the server hostname given by your provider.
- VPN type: pick the protocol your provider supports (if unsure, use “Automatic” or the provider app).
- Type of sign-in info: usually “Username and password”; for certificate-based or token logins, choose accordingly.
- Save.
- Connect
- Return to VPN list, select the profile, click Connect.
- Windows shows connection status in Settings and the taskbar network icon.
Section 2 โ Protocols, when to use which
- WireGuard: modern, fast, and simple โ great for streaming and low-latency tasks.
- OpenVPN: mature and secure; good for robust compatibility. Note: OpenVPN 2.7 contains performance and security improvements; update server/client when possible (see further reading).
- IKEv2: stable on mobile and quick to re-establish connections after network switches.
- L2TP/IPsec: legacy; only use when required, and ensure strong pre-shared keys/certificates.
Section 3 โ Common setup mistakes and how to fix them
- Wrong server address or typo
- Symptom: “Couldn’t connect” or immediate disconnect.
- Fix: Copy-paste the server address from your provider dashboard; avoid extra spaces.
- Incorrect username/password or auth method
- Symptom: Authentication errors.
- Fix: Verify credentials on the provider site; remember some services use separate VPN credentials not identical to your account login.
- Protocol mismatch
- Symptom: Connection attempts time out or fail during negotiation.
- Fix: Switch VPN type in the Windows profile to match the providerโs recommended protocol; if using OpenVPN, prefer the provider’s client or import an OVPN profile.
- Missing certificates / pre-shared keys
- Symptom: Immediate failure when using certificate-based auth.
- Fix: Install or import the certificate as instructed and confirm the path in the profile; for pre-shared keys, paste exactly as provided.
- DNS leaks and split tunneling confusion
- Symptom: Sites show your ISP DNS or local IP-sensitive content is blocked.
- Fix: Use provider DNS or enable provider appโs DNS leak protection. For Windows built-in profiles, configure adapter DNS or use the providerโs recommended servers.
- Firewall/antivirus interference
- Symptom: Connection blocked or dropped after handshake.
- Fix: Temporarily disable third-party security tools to test; add the VPN client to allowed apps; ensure Windows Firewall allows the protocol ports.
- ISP or network blocking VPN traffic
- Symptom: Connections fail on public or restricted networks.
- Fix: Try using OpenVPN over TCP (port 443) or WireGuard if supported. Obfuscated or stealth modes in provider apps help circumvent deep packet inspection.
Section 4 โ Diagnosing connection failures (tools and steps)
- Test ping to the server hostname: no response may indicate DNS or routing issues.
- Use IP check sites to see if your IP and DNS are replaced after connecting.
- Review Windows Event Viewer for VPN or RasClient errors.
- Capture logs from the provider app; they often point to auth, certificate, or protocol problems.
Section 5 โ Advanced tweaks for reliability and privacy
- Use a trustworthy password manager to store VPN credentials securely; password managers reduce errors copying usernames or complex passwords. (See comparison in further reading.)
- Enable kill switch (app feature) to prevent traffic leaks when the VPN drops.
- Configure split tunneling only when necessary โ default to routing all traffic through the VPN for privacy.
- Set DNS servers manually on the VPN adapter for consistent queries.
- Keep client and server software updated (OpenVPN 2.7 includes important fixes).
Section 6 โ When to use the providerโs app vs built-in Windows VPN
- Use the provider app when you want: seamless server lists, protocol selection, automatic killswitch, obfuscation, and streaming-optimized servers.
- Use built-in Windows profile when: you require manual control, are on a corporate setup, or need to avoid installing extra software.
Section 7 โ Router and multi-device considerations
- Some routers accept OpenVPN or WireGuard profiles; configuring the router protects all connected devices but requires correct server and auth details.
- For streaming devices without native VPN support, consider a router-level VPN or a VPN-capable travel router.
Section 8 โ Security hygiene and account safety
- Rotate VPN passwords if you suspect a leak.
- Use strong, unique passwords stored in a password manager; enable MFA where offered for account access to the provider dashboard.
- Prefer providers with audited no-logs policies and transparent privacy practices.
Section 9 โ Troubleshooting examples (real scenarios)
- Example: “Could not validate credentials” โ user had two-step verification enabled for their account portal; provider uses separate VPN credentials. Solution: Generate site-specific VPN credentials via provider dashboard.
- Example: “Connection established but web traffic still shows my ISP” โ DNS leak. Solution: Set DNS to providerโs servers or enable DNS leak protection in app.

Final tips before you go
- Keep a backup connection method (mobile hotspot) to test whether your home ISP is blocking VPNs.
- If speed is an issue, try different nearby servers or switch to WireGuard/OpenVPN UDP for better performance.
- If you rely on VPNs for work, ask your IT team for recommended protocols and certificates to avoid policy conflicts.
